Evan holds a Masters Degree in Voice from Western University. In addition to performances in Italy, B.C and the U.S. he has appeared in a broad array of musicals, including: the role of Lumiere in "Beauty & the Beast", Snoopy in "You're a Good Man, Charlie Brown", Fagin in "Oliver", the Phantom, in "The Phantom of the Opera", the Genie in "Aladdin Jr." the father in the opera "Hansel and Gretel" and most recently the chef in "The Little Mermaid".
